Crosfields needed to bag some points in this weeks match as they slipped further behind Cherrybrook and Cadishead, and a third place spot was beginning to look like the best they could hope for.
Ben Bedford and Richie Norman were off, so the starting line up was Luke Prescott left wing, Nathan Redmond centre forward, Thomas Ley right, Ben Crank centre midfield, with Matthew Prescott and Cameron Henderson like David and Golieth in defence. Baylie Coates in Goal.
From the start of the game Appleton played with flair and the crowd knew this would be a tough game for Crosfields, who were always slow starters. Appleton seemed in control until Nathan Redmond had a good long run down the pitch to worry for the first time the Appleton defence and goal keeper. Every chance he had Redmond showed strong determination and pressured the keeper in the hope that he may make a mistake that Redmond could capitalise on.
The Crosfields forwards were needed to bolster the defence in the first few minutes, and it was all hands to the pump as Thomas Ley headed the ball out for an Appleton corner. As the corner came in it was well defended by Luke Prescott, and after a goal area scramble, Matthew Prescott cleared the ball to safety.
Appleton were very strong and after a delightful passing movement, the Appleton no 6 put the ball into the back of the Crosfield net. 1 - 0 Appleton.
Following this Crosfields put together great moves, Coates kicking the ball out wide to Ley, who passed to Redmond in the centre, out wide to the left and Luke Prescott who was just unable to keep the ball in play. Appleton took the throw in which was met by Ben Crank of Crosfields, who looked up a took a long range shot on goal, that just went over the bar.
The game continued with end to end action, there were good defensive moves from both Cameron Henderson and Matthew Prescott, and several impressive runs from Ben Crank, Luke Prescott and Thomas Ley.
Substitutions were made and Cameron Henderson and Luke Prescott came of for Richie Norman and Ben Bedford to come on in like for like positions. Crosfields contiued to be strong particularly down the right and Nathan Redmond battled hard against the Appleton defence. Thomas Ley put a great ball into the box to be met by the head of Ben Bedford, unfortunately missing the target.
A series of balls rained into the Appleton area, and although Redmond kept up the relentless pressure on the Appleton keeper, he kept his cool and as the halftime whistle blew it remained 1 - 0 to Appleton.
When Crosfields returned to the pitch Nathan Redmond had been substituted for Luke Prescott, and Matthew Prescott came off for Cameron Henderson. Luke Prescott returned to the left and Ben Bedford was moved to centre forward. Play resumed in much the same vein as the first half until Appleton were awarded a free kick. This was struck well and flew over all the players and into the back of the net. 2 - 0 Appleton.
Crosfields then collectively stepped up to the mark, Luke Prescott having a shot on goal following a great long pass from Ben Crank. After another goal area scramble, resulting in a shot from Cameron Henderson which went out for a goal kick. Ben Crank was well into stride picking off the goal kicks, he put a beautiful ball forward in a long mid air pass which fell nicely for Ben Bedford, who put it past the Appleton goalie. 2 - 1.
The team continued with this momentum and it wasn't long before Thomas Ley took the ball down the right, crossed into the area only to rebound out and for Ley to slam the ball accurately into the Appleton goal. 2 - 2.
Appleton fought well and responded with a break, after Baylie Coates came out to punch the ball to safety it fell back at Appleton feet and after what the crowd suspected was going to be a third goal for Appleton, Luke Prescott confused the Appleton striker by sticking with him tightly and nipping the ball away.
Thomas Ley and Ben Crank substituted for Nathan Redmond and Matthew Prescott. Play continued in a battle of two evenly matched teams and you could feel the tension of all the supporters, as neither team could monopolise on their chances. In the dying minutes the referee awarded Appleton a free kick after a strong tackle by Nathan Redmond, who had worked hard since returning to the pitch. The Crosfields supporters held their breathe as Appleton took the free kick which was cleared out for a corner by Richie Norman. The Appleton corner produced some great defending by Matthew Prescott, and as the ball was cleared up the pitch the Ref blew the final whistle.
Final Result Crosfields 2 - 2 Appleton
Scorers Ben Bedford 1, Thomas Ley 1
Man of the Match - Nathan Redmond
